description Venus Express Overview

Venus Express was a European Space Agency spacecraft launched in 2005 and placed into orbit around Venus in 2006. As ESA's first mission to the planet, it studied the atmosphere, clouds, surface environment, and interaction between the solar wind and Venusian plasma. Its observations were used by planetary scientists investigating atmospheric circulation, climate evolution, and the loss of water from Venus.

help Venus Express FAQ

Which space agency launched the Venus Express mission?

Venus Express was a spacecraft launched by the European Space Agency (ESA) in 2005 from the Baikonur Cosmodrome. It successfully entered orbit around Venus in 2006.

What scientific observations did the Venus Express spacecraft conduct?

As ESA's first mission to the planet, it extensively studied the Venusian atmosphere, dense cloud cover, and surface environment. The orbiter also measured the complex interaction between the solar wind and the planet's plasma.

How did the Venus Express mission end?

The spacecraft far exceeded its planned operational lifespan, continuing to transmit scientific data until late 2014. The mission officially concluded when the probe ran out of propellant and burned up in the Venusian atmosphere in early 2015.

Was the Venus Express spacecraft built from scratch?

No, to save money and development time, ESA constructed Venus Express by heavily reusing the design and spare parts from the Mars Express orbiter. The primary scientific instruments were also closely adapted from previous ESA missions like Mars Express and the Rosetta comet probe.
